Braintree SDK checks for SU. It could possibly be a resource killer. https://github.com/braintree/braintree_android …pic.twitter.com/xFVPNmlsIw
It seems they don't use the latest version of the Braintree SDK. In the app, the isDeviceRooted method is in AnalyticsIntentService but in Github version it's in http://AnalyticsSender.java
